voxeljet technology at EUROGUSS 2010 voxeljet technology launched its 2010 trade show season at EUROGUSS 2010 in Nuremberg. A total of 7,141 specialists—one quarter of them from abroad—visited the trade show, which ended successfully on 21 January after a three-day run. 364 exhibitors at EUROGUSS demonstrated all kinds of diecasting products and services, from diecast parts, materials, furnaces, diecasting machinery and dies to finishing, quality control and research and development. | ||

voxeljet presented its entire range of 3D printing technology with a special focus on applications in connection with diecasting. EUROGUSS visitors experienced the connection between plastic models, produced in voxeljet's' 3D printing systems, and metal parts produced with diecasting processes.
Diecasting is an ideal way to produce modern high-tech metal components with complex shapes and high quality requirements. However, before mass production can begin, manufacturers need prototypes that correspond to the mass-produced components as precisely as possible. | |
|
Because diecasting moulds are relatively complex and expensive to produce, they only pay off when produced on a large scale. An alternative is to produce prototypes and small batches by investment casting, which uses wax models that melt during the diecasting process. The use of voxeljet's 3D plastic printing method allows highly precise wax models to be produced economically. voxeljet's 3D plastic printers use generative manufacturing methods to produce the wax parts or lost models directly from 3D CAD data without additional tools or extra processing steps. After being cast, these models deliver prototypes whose quality is comparable to mass-produced diecast parts.
